Why extreme heat puts stress on your foundation

Extreme heat rarely damages concrete directly. The bigger issue is what heat does to the soil supporting the foundation.

Soil types across Maryland and Delaware vary widely. Parts of the region, including areas of the Piedmont and transitional zones, contain clay soils that hold water when wet and lose it during a drought. 

The Eastern Shore and much of the Coastal Plain are more sandy and drain quickly. 

Clay-heavy soils are the ones most likely to shrink and swell with moisture changes, which is why the risk depends on your specific site.

When moisture-sensitive soil dries, it shrinks and can pull away from the foundation. That shrinkage removes support from under the footing, and cracks may follow.

Here is what can happen during a long heat wave:

  • Soil shrinkage: dry clay contracts and can create gaps under and around the footing.
  • Thermal cycling: concrete expands in the heat and contracts as nights cool. Repeated cycling can stress weak points over time.
  • Drought stress: weeks without rain lower overall soil moisture and can speed up settlement in vulnerable soils.
  • Tree root thirst: roots pull additional moisture from the soil near the foundation during hot, dry spells.

Heat-related movement is often gradual. By the time cracks appear, the soil underneath may have already shifted, which is why early monitoring matters.

How soil shrinkage turns into foundation cracks

Think of your foundation as a rigid concrete box resting on soil. When heat dries that soil unevenly, the box can settle unevenly too.

Uneven settlement concentrates stress at the weakest points of the concrete. That is why cracks often appear near corners, window openings, and the areas where soil dried out fastest.

Factors that influence how serious a foundation cracks gets:

  • Soil type: clay-rich soils shrink and swell the most; sandy soils move much less.
  • Sun exposure: south- and west-facing walls tend to dry out faster.
  • Water management: gutters, downspouts, and grading control how much moisture the soil keeps.
  • Vegetation: large trees and shrubs planted close to the house draw moisture from the soil.

Types of Foundation Cracks Caused by Extreme Heat

Not all foundation cracks mean the same thing. The shape and direction of a crack can tell you a lot about what is happening below.

Hairline Cracks

Thin, shallow lines that often appear as concrete cures or during a hot summer. They are usually cosmetic, but they are still worth monitoring and sealing to keep water out.

Vertical Cracks

These run up and down and are usually linked to normal settling or minor shrinkage. A vertical crack that stays narrow is often lower risk, but one that widens at either end deserves a professional look.

Diagonal Cracks

Cracks at roughly 30 to 45 degrees can point to differential settlement, meaning one part of the foundation moves more than another. Heat-driven soil shrinkage is one possible trigger, though other causes exist.

Stair-Step Cracks

In block or brick foundations, settlement can show up as stair-step cracks along the mortar joints. These are worth having inspected, especially after a hot, dry summer.

Horizontal Cracks

Horizontal cracks are the ones to take most seriously. They can indicate that a wall is under heavy soil pressure and may be bowing. If you see one, do not wait: schedule a foundation inspection and repair visit.

Foundation Cracks’ Rule of Thumb: 

Hairline and narrow vertical cracks are often cosmetic. Diagonal, stair-step, and horizontal cracks are more likely to be structural and should be evaluated.

Signs Your Foundation Cracks Are Getting Worse

Foundation cracks rarely stay exactly the same over time. Watch for these warning signs during and after a heat wave:

  • A crack that widens, lengthens, or changes direction.
  • A crack wider than about 1/4 inch.
  • Doors and windows that start sticking or will not latch.
  • Uneven or sloping floors.
  • Gaps between walls and ceilings, or around window frames.
  • Water seeping through a crack after a summer storm. Our article on summer storms and your foundation covers that combination.

How Foundation Cracks Caused by Extreme Heat Are Typically Handled

The right approach depends on the crack type, how much it has moved, and what the soil is doing. Here is how these cracks are usually addressed.

Step 1: Monitor and Seal Small Cracks

For hairline and narrow vertical cracks, the goal is keeping water out and tracking movement:

  • Measure the width and take a dated photo.
  • Mark the ends of the crack with a pencil so you can spot growth.
  • Seal hairline cracks with a suitable concrete sealant.
  • Keep soil moisture consistent so the crack does not cycle open and closed.

Step 2: Address the Water and Soil Conditions

Before repairing concrete, it helps to correct the conditions that contributed to the crack. Otherwise, new cracks can appear.

  • Extend downspouts away from the foundation.
  • Regrade soil so water flows away from the house.
  • Add drainage solutions such as French drains where water pools near the footing.
  • Mulch planting beds to slow evaporation during extreme heat.

How to Reduce the Risk of New Cracks During Heat Waves

You cannot control the weather, but you can influence the moisture around your foundation. A few habits go a long way during extreme heat:

  • Water the soil, not the concrete. A soaker hose placed a few feet from the foundation helps keep clay soils from shrinking.
  • Water deeply and less often, following any local watering restrictions.
  • Keep mulch about 3 to 4 inches deep to shade the soil.
  • Plant large trees far enough away that roots do not dry out the footing.
  • Keep gutters clean and downspouts extended.

FAQs About Foundation Cracks and Extreme Heat

Can extreme heat really cause foundation cracks?

Yes. In moisture-sensitive soils, extreme heat dries and shrinks the ground, which can remove support from under the footing and lead to settlement and cracking. The effect often shows up weeks after the heat wave ends.

1. Are all foundation cracks structural?

No. Hairline and narrow vertical cracks are often cosmetic. Diagonal, stair-step, and horizontal cracks are more likely to be structural and should be inspected.

2. Do foundation cracks get worse after summer?

They can. When dry summer soil gets soaked by fall storms, it can swell and push against the foundation. That cycle may widen existing cracks. A similar pattern can occur in winter, as explained in our foundation cracks after winter article.

3. Will watering my foundation stop foundation cracks?

Consistent moisture can reduce soil shrinkage and lower the risk of new cracks, but it will not reverse settlement that has already happened. Watering is a prevention habit, not a repair.

4. How fast should I act on heat-related foundation cracks?

Hairline cracks can usually be monitored for a season. Wide, growing, or horizontal cracks should be inspected promptly, because early repair is often simpler than waiting.
